# instrument # instrument
notes:
- the entire instrument is stored, regardless of instrument type.
- the macro range varies depending on the instrument type.
- "macro open" indicates whether the macro is collapsed or not in the instrument editor.
- FM operator order is:
- 1/3/2/4 (internal order) for OPN, OPM, OPZ and OPL 4-op
- 1/2/?/? (? = unused) for OPL 2-op and OPLL
- meaning of extended macros varies depending on instrument type.
- meaning of panning macros varies depending on instrument type:
- for hard-panned chips (e.g. FM and Game Boy): left panning is 2-bit panning macro (left/right)
- otherwise both left and right panning macros are used
